服务器故障排查指南
服务器问题的常见原因及解决方法
在现代网络时代,无论是个人用户还是企业组织,都需要依赖稳定的服务器来支撑各种在线服务和应用,服务器问题可能随时发生,给用户的体验带来极大的不便,本文将探讨一些常见的服务器问题及其解决方案。
网络连接问题
问题描述
最常见的服务器问题是与互联网连接中断或不稳定,这可能导致数据传输延迟、无法访问网站或应用程序等严重后果。
解决方案
1、检查网络设置:确保您的设备已正确配置了IP地址,并且路由器和交换机的设置没有错误。
2、重启网络设备:尝试重启路由器、调制解调器或其他网络设备以恢复其正常工作状态。
3、优化网络配置:根据需要调整路由器的无线频道、信号强度和其他相关参数。
硬件故障
问题描述
服务器硬件(如硬盘、内存条、CPU)出现故障时,可能会导致性能下降、数据丢失等问题。
解决方案
1、定期维护:对服务器进行定期的硬件检查和维护,及时发现并修复潜在问题。
2、备用方案:为关键系统准备冗余硬件组件,确保在主硬件出现问题时能够迅速切换到备用资源。
3、备份数据:定期备份服务器上的重要数据,以防数据丢失或损坏。
软件冲突或崩溃
问题描述
服务器软件可能出现兼容性问题、运行错误或被恶意程序攻击等情况,从而影响系统的稳定性和安全性。
解决方案
1、更新软件:确保所有使用的软件都是最新版本,以获取最新的安全补丁和功能改进。
2、监控日志:通过监控服务器的日志文件,及时发现异常行为和错误信息,快速定位问题源。
3、防火墙和反病毒措施:启用防火墙保护系统免受外部攻击,安装防病毒软件,定期扫描系统以检测和清除恶意软件。
系统负载过高
问题描述
当服务器面临过高的并发请求量时,可能会因为处理能力不足而陷入瘫痪状态,导致用户体验不佳甚至系统崩溃。
解决方案
1、增加资源:通过添加更多的计算节点或扩展现有资源来提升服务器的处理能力和容量。
2、分批处理任务:合理分配任务,避免同一时间大量任务集中加载服务器,可以采用多线程或多进程技术。
3、优化代码:审查和优化服务器端代码,减少不必要的计算开销和IO操作,提高响应速度。
认证和授权问题
问题描述
由于密码泄露、口令破解或未正确配置认证机制等原因,可能导致账户被盗用、权限滥用等问题。
解决方案
1、加强密码策略:要求使用复杂度高的密码,并定期更换密码。
2、双因素验证:实施双因素身份验证,增加账户的安全性。
3、审计和监控:建立详细的账号管理和访问控制日志记录,定期审核系统中的安全事件和异常活动。
服务器问题无处不在,但通过合理的预防措施和有效的应对策略,完全可以降低这些问题带来的风险,对于企业和开发者而言,持续关注服务器健康状况,并采取必要的防护措施,将是保证业务连续性和用户满意度的关键。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库